Clicking on <menuchoice>Add Login Script...</menuchoice> will open a file picker. Select a script, and then click <menuchoice>Open</menuchoice>. The script will then appear in a new "Login Scripts" section, below the Applications section. Clicking on <menuchoice>Add Logout Script...</menuchoice> does the same thing as <menuchoice>Add Login Script...</menuchoice>, only this time, the script appears in a section called "Logout Scripts".
